I need your help to determine whether this is a game bug in my case, or if I've overlooked something.
My game ended in a draw, and I lost in the final scoring.
The official rulebook states that in the event of a draw, the player with fewer empty spaces in their city wins.
I had 2 empty fields, my opponent had 6, but I lost.

Not a bug.
The first tie breaker is actually the number of turns as master builder. Your opponent finished the game at least 3 turns before you, so you lost.
If you had the same number of master builder turn, then it is the empty spaces count and then the cottages number.

Please note that this tiebreaker appears to be different than what's in the German rulebook, at least from my reading of it. The BGA implementation matches the English rulebook.
